Within ten days after any draft on the letter of credit, <br />the Company shall furnish the City with a new letter of credit in <br />the full amount of $10,000. <br />Section 1-9. Indemnification and Defense of Claims. <br />A. The Company shall, at its sole cost and expense, fully <br />indemnify, defend and hold harmless the City, its officers, <br />agents and employees against any and all claims, suits, actions, <br />• liability, judgments or damages, including but not limited to <br />those: <br />(1) For injury to persons or property, in any ray <br />arising out of or through the acts or omissions of Company, its <br />servants, agents or employees or to which Company's negligence <br />shall in any ray contribute; <br />(2) Arising out of or through the acts or omissions of the <br />Company for invasion of the right of privacy, for defamation of <br />any person, firm or corporation, or the violation or infringement <br />of any copyright, trademark, trade name, service mark or patent, <br />or of any other right of any person, firm or corporation <br />(excluding claims arising out of or relating to the City's own <br />programming); <br />(3) Arising out of the Company's alleged failure to comply <br />with the provisions of any federal, state, or local statute, <br />ordinance or regulation applicable to the Company in its business <br />hereunder. <br />(4) Arising out of the Company's alleged failure to comply <br />with the civil rights of any person, firm or corporation; <br />0 <br />
